Description
The Supervisorof the Roamer Teamis a leadership role with expended responsibilities identified as having both an operational and people focus. The ideal candidate will manage team members and operations designated by the Manager of Reception.
In this role, you will have a strong focus on coaching and developing a staff of Roamers, collaborating with Senior Supervisors to ensure consistency across the Reception Team. Your role will oversee metrics, SLAs and Roamer dispatch while guiding them in areas of coaching, development and managing their performance. Your goal is to ensure we provide a customer-centric experience through each interaction and consistently communicate and support the implementation of Reception Best Practices. You will own the execution of a variety of projects, audits and working to improve processes to increase team’s overall efficiency.
Amazon is a fast-paced demanding corporate environment and we are committed to providing professional 5-star customer service with every interaction. Flexibility in working various hours and sometimes weekends is required in order to be available for the team you will manage.

Key responsibilities
Operational Responsibilities
- Manage daily resourcing (call-outs, roamer shifts, etc.)
- Establish escalation boundaries and protocol for Lead Receptionists regarding desk operations.
- Ensure appropriate staffing levels.
- Communicate and support consistent implementation of reception practices.
- Ensure program service level agreements and operation standards are met or exceeded, inclusive of staffing levels, email response times, and overall customer satisfaction.
- Plan and develop employee work schedules, coordinating break coverage ensuring the best use of resources.
- Become the subject matter expert of all building operations including, but not limited to, security access levels, facility procedures, vendor points of contact, and any escalation processes.
- Work with outside vendors on procurement of materials holding vendors accountable for deliverables and associated spend.
Training
- Work with SEABEL training team on overall best training practices for new hire and ongoing training.
- Manage Reception Desk Trainer for successful onboarding experience for all new hires.
People Responsibilities
- Manage performance by establishing clear expectations, evaluating performance against goals, and correcting performance as needed.
- Coach and develop to facilitate success in current role and readiness for potential growth into other roles.
- Hire talent to ensure the right people are in the right role.
- Collaborate with Lead Receptionists to hire, coach and develop, and manage the performance of all Receptionists.
- Assist leadership in interviewing, hiring, and termination discussions.
- Foster a spirit of teamwork and unity among team members that allows for disagreement over ideas, conflict and expeditious conflict resolution.
Customer Experience
- Ensure that your team is clear on the expectation to provide elevated customer support for callers, visitors, community members, vendor partners, and all guests entering Amazon space.
- Act as liaison between Northwest Center, Amazon and other Vendors ensure continuity across campus locations.

About Northwest Center
When People of all Abilities Learn and Work Together, Everyone Benefits. The purpose of Northwest Center is to change society so that people of all abilities engage with each other fully in classrooms, workplaces, and the community. Legally structured as a 501(c)3 nonprofit corporation, Northwest Center is more broadly a "for-purpose" organization that uses and blends the best techniques of human services, business, and philanthropy in innovative ways.
As a social enterprise organization, Northwest Center proves to the world every day that employing people of all abilities can be a powerful competitive advantage. Northwest Center’s businesses generate over $5 million annually that Northwest Center reinvests into human services while covering 100% of the overhead expense of the organization and building cash reserves for future sustainability.
Northwest Center’s mission is to promote the growth, development, and independence of people with disabilities through programs of therapy, education, and work opportunity
